    watchdog: gpio: Convert to use GPIO descriptors
    
    This converts the GPIO watchdog driver to use GPIO descriptors
    instead of relying on the old method to read out GPIO numbers
    from the device tree and then using those with the old GPIO
    API.
    
    The descriptor API keeps track of whether the line is active
    low so we can remove all active low handling and rely on the
    GPIO descriptor to deal with this for us.

 drivers/watchdog/gpio_wdt.c | 41 +++++++++++++++++------------------------
 1 file changed, 17 insertions(+), 24 deletions(-)

diff --git a/drivers/watchdog/gpio_wdt.c b/drivers/watchdog/gpio_wdt.c
index 448e6c3ba73c..b077c88a5ceb 100644
--- a/drivers/watchdog/gpio_wdt.c
+++ b/drivers/watchdog/gpio_wdt.c
@@ -12,7 +12,8 @@
 #include <linux/err.h>
 #include <linux/delay.h>
 #include <linux/module.h>
-#include <linux/of_gpio.h>
+#include <linux/gpio/consumer.h>
+#include <linux/of.h>
 #include <linux/platform_device.h>
 #include <linux/watchdog.h>
 
@@ -25,8 +26,7 @@ enum {
 };
 
 struct gpio_wdt_priv {
-	int			gpio;
-	bool			active_low;
+	struct gpio_desc	*gpiod;
 	bool			state;
 	bool			always_running;
 	unsigned int		hw_algo;
@@ -35,11 +35,12 @@ struct gpio_wdt_priv {
 
 static void gpio_wdt_disable(struct gpio_wdt_priv *priv)
 {
-	gpio_set_value_cansleep(priv->gpio, !priv->active_low);
+	/* Eternal ping */
+	gpiod_set_value_cansleep(priv->gpiod, 1);
 
 	/* Put GPIO back to tristate */
 	if (priv->hw_algo == HW_ALGO_TOGGLE)
-		gpio_direction_input(priv->gpio);
+		gpiod_direction_input(priv->gpiod);
 }
 
 static int gpio_wdt_ping(struct watchdog_device *wdd)
@@ -50,13 +51,13 @@ static int gpio_wdt_ping(struct watchdog_device *wdd)
 	case HW_ALGO_TOGGLE:
 		/* Toggle output pin */
 		priv->state = !priv->state;
-		gpio_set_value_cansleep(priv->gpio, priv->state);
+		gpiod_set_value_cansleep(priv->gpiod, priv->state);
 		break;
 	case HW_ALGO_LEVEL:
 		/* Pulse */
-		gpio_set_value_cansleep(priv->gpio, !priv->active_low);
+		gpiod_set_value_cansleep(priv->gpiod, 1);
 		udelay(1);
-		gpio_set_value_cansleep(priv->gpio, priv->active_low);
+		gpiod_set_value_cansleep(priv->gpiod, 0);
 		break;
 	}
 	return 0;
@@ -66,8 +67,8 @@ static int gpio_wdt_start(struct watchdog_device *wdd)
 {
 	struct gpio_wdt_priv *priv = watchdog_get_drvdata(wdd);
 
-	priv->state = priv->active_low;
-	gpio_direction_output(priv->gpio, priv->state);
+	priv->state = 0;
+	gpiod_direction_output(priv->gpiod, priv->state);
 
 	set_bit(WDOG_HW_RUNNING, &wdd->status);
 
@@ -104,9 +105,8 @@ static int gpio_wdt_probe(struct platform_device *pdev)
 	struct device *dev = &pdev->dev;
 	struct device_node *np = dev->of_node;
 	struct gpio_wdt_priv *priv;
-	enum of_gpio_flags flags;
+	enum gpiod_flags gflags;
 	unsigned int hw_margin;
-	unsigned long f = 0;
 	const char *algo;
 	int ret;
 
@@ -116,29 +116,22 @@ static int gpio_wdt_probe(struct platform_device *pdev)
 
 	platform_set_drvdata(pdev, priv);
 
-	priv->gpio = of_get_gpio_flags(np, 0, &flags);
-	if (!gpio_is_valid(priv->gpio))
-		return priv->gpio;
-
-	priv->active_low = flags & OF_GPIO_ACTIVE_LOW;
-
 	ret = of_property_read_string(np, "hw_algo", &algo);
 	if (ret)
 		return ret;
 	if (!strcmp(algo, "toggle")) {
 		priv->hw_algo = HW_ALGO_TOGGLE;
-		f = GPIOF_IN;
+		gflags = GPIOD_IN;
 	} else if (!strcmp(algo, "level")) {
 		priv->hw_algo = HW_ALGO_LEVEL;
-		f = priv->active_low ? GPIOF_OUT_INIT_HIGH : GPIOF_OUT_INIT_LOW;
+		gflags = GPIOD_OUT_LOW;
 	} else {
 		return -EINVAL;
 	}
 
-	ret = devm_gpio_request_one(dev, priv->gpio, f,
-				    dev_name(dev));
-	if (ret)
-		return ret;
+	priv->gpiod = devm_gpiod_get(dev, NULL, gflags);
+	if (IS_ERR(priv->gpiod))
+		return PTR_ERR(priv->gpiod);
 
 	ret = of_property_read_u32(np,
 				   "hw_margin_ms", &hw_margin);
